Fixing the TV on a wall
This TV should be fixed on a wall only with the wall fix bracket available from SHARP (Page 5). The use 
of other wall fix brackets may result in an unstable installation and may cause serious injuries.
Fixing the LCD colour TV requires special skills and should only be performed by qualified service 
personnel. Customers should not attempt to do the work themselves. SHARP bears no responsibility 
for improper fixing or fixing that results in accident or injury.
You can ask qualified service personnel about using an optional bracket to fix the TV on a wall.
To use this TV fixed on a wall, first remove the adhesive tape at the two locations on the rear of the TV, and then 
use the screws supplied with the wall fix bracket to secure the bracket to the rear of the TV.
When you fix the TV on a wall, you should attach the supporting post.
